Sheila Temple Book Signing March 1 at Library Center

Local author Sheila Temple will sell and sign copies of her new book, “Chinese Take Out: An Adoption Memoir,” from 10 a.m.-2 p.m. on Saturday, March 1, at the Library Center, 4653 S. Campbell Ave. She will also have copies available of her children’s book, “Gotcha Day: A Celebration of Adoption.”

“Chinese Take Out” is the story of the author’s children and their adoptions at the ages of 3, 6 and 12. “Loving our children has never been the issue. But the medical, social, spiritual and cultural challenges have been earthshaking – to say the least!”

In “Gotcha Day,” the author explains to children that love is what makes a family, regardless of race or nationality.
